A growing number of young people across Europe are turning to artificial intelligence (AI) chatbots for emotional support and discussions about personal issues, according to a recent Ipsos BVA survey commissioned by France’s privacy watchdog CNIL and insurer Groupe VYV. Experts warn of rising ‘AI psychosis’
Psychologists have raised alarm over a disturbing new mental health condition linked to the excessive use of artificial intelligence chatbots such as ChatGPT, Claude, and Replika, warning that dependency on digital companions can lead to emotional addiction and even delusional thinking.
